Affordability

Plane tickets, hotels, expensive restaurants…the costs for your average vacation can really add up. With an RV, however, you can skip many of these expenses.

How much money you save depends on how you plan your trip. But staying at RV resorts, buying groceries, and cooking your own meals will definitely be kinder on your pocketbook than a conventional vacation would be. Lower gas mileage can be a cost concern with an RV, but savings elsewhere more than makeup for it.

Comfort

A road trip with an RV lets you bring the comfort of home along with you since you’re not restricted by carry-on weight limits. Hence, you can bring a favorite book, a favorite blanket, or even the family dog. Assuming you aren’t behind the wheel, you can cozy up in the back and relax while en route to the next destination. You can even enjoy a drink or a nap on the way!

Depending on how many passengers are along for the trip, there are a number of different models of RV you can choose from for your road trip. A traveling couple can make do with a small trailer, but if you plan to bring the kids (and even pets!) along, you might want to go for a roomier option.

Many RV models contain all the amenities of a small home–from a kitchen to a bathroom and various sleeping surfaces.

Flexibility

The sky’s the limit when planning an RV road trip. RV rentals give you a space you can personalize to your preferences and the freedom to improvise as you travel.

If you decide to take the scenic route, the flexibility that RVs offer will help support spontaneity. On longer road trips, you have the option to stop and check out sites that you might have just flown by otherwise.
